Lewis Hamilton admits he is only concentrating on ensuring his own preparations for the new Formula 1 season after the first test in Barcelona.

The Mercedes driver, known not to be a big fan of testing, only completed two afternoons on Monday and Thursday yet he was still able to end the latter with the fastest time, three-tenths shy of the best over the four days but using one-step harder tyre compound.

Given the cold temperatures and lack of representative running, making any solid conclusions is very tricky, but even if it wasn't Hamilton admits that would not be his priority.

“Honestly I just don’t focus too much on anyone else," the Briton told the official F1 website. "I think ultimately for me and my mindset, if I am at my best then I should have no problems. That’s how I approach it.

"I don’t prepare myself and then hope that the next guy has issues so I can capitalise on them, I want him to be at his best because then it’s more painful for them when you do out-perform them.”

The four-time and defending world champion also insists he is wanting a tight battle with the likes of Ferrari and Red Bull for the championship this year.

“The closer it is, the better it is when you win," he claimed. "You want the guys you are racing to have a level playing field that you can really show that there are only small differences between us as drivers, and you want to be able to show that. It’s magnified if the cars are all the same.”
